Brief Explanation of Red Light Therapy:
Red light therapy, also known as low-level laser therapy (LLLT), involves exposing tissues to specific wavelengths of red light. This therapy is believed to stimulate cellular activity and promote healing by increasing blood flow, reducing inflammation, and enhancing tissue repair.

Power Output and Spectrum:
The power output and spectrum are crucial factors. Opt for devices that emit red light in the range of 630-670 nm, as this wavelength is most effective for healing tissues. Higher power outputs can provide faster results but should be used with caution to avoid skin burns.
Treatment Time and Frequency:
Treatment duration and frequency are important. Devices that offer adjustable treatment timesranging from 5 to 10 minutesare ideal, and using them a few times a week is recommended. Regular use can yield the best results.

How to Use the Device Effectively:
To use the device effectively:
- Position the device at a distance of 4-6 inches from your dogs skin.
- Treat the affected areas for 5-10 minutes, depending on the devices recommended time.
- Use the device regularly, following the guidelines provided by the manufacturer.
Safety Precautions and Potential Side Effects:
- Avoid direct contact with the eyes.
- Use the device as directed to avoid skin burns.
- Monitor your dog for any adverse reactions, such as skin redness or irritation.
